| bool MetricsLibrary::ConsentId(std::string* id) { |
| // Do not allow symlinks. |
| base::ScopedFD fd( |
| open(consent_file_.value().c_str(), O_RDONLY | O_CLOEXEC | O_NOFOLLOW)); |
| if (fd.get() < 0) |
| return false; |
| |
| // We declare a slightly larger buffer than needed so we can detect if it's |
| // been corrupted with a lot of bad data. |
| char buf[40]; |
| ssize_t len = read(fd.get(), buf, sizeof(buf)); |
| |
| // If we couldn't get any data, just fail right away. |
| if (len <= 0) |
| return false; |
| |
| // Chop the trailing newline to make parsing below easier. |
| if (buf[len - 1] == '\n') |
| buf[--len] = '\0'; |
| |
| // Make sure it's a valid UUID. Support older installs that omitted dashes. |
| if (len != 32 && len != 36) |
| return false; |
| |
| ssize_t i; |
| id->clear(); |
| for (i = 0; i < len; ++i) { |
| char c = buf[i]; |
| *id += c; |
| |
| // For long UUIDs, require dashes at certain positions. |
| if (len == 36 && (i == 8 || i == 13 || i == 18 || i == 23)) { |
| if (c == '-') |
| continue; |
| return false; |
| } |
| |
| // All the rest should be hexdigits. |
| if (base::IsHexDigit(c)) |
| continue; |
| |
| return false; |
| } |
| |
| return true; |
| } |

| // AppSync opt-in/UMA consent are determined as follows: |
| // * if all users logged in have opted in, return true |
| // * if at least one user has not opted in, return false |
| // * if no users exist, there can be no apps to sync, return false |
| std::optional<bool> MetricsLibrary::CheckUserConsent( |
| const base::FilePath& root_path, std::string consent_file) { |
| base::FileEnumerator consent_files( |
| root_path, |
| /*recursive=*/true, base::FileEnumerator::FILES, consent_file, |
| base::FileEnumerator::FolderSearchPolicy::ALL); |
| SafeFD::SafeFDResult root_err = SafeFD::Root(); |
| if (SafeFD::IsError(root_err.second)) { |
| LOG(ERROR) << "Failed to open root directory: " |
| << static_cast<int>(root_err.second); |
| return std::nullopt; |
| } |
| bool checked_any = false; |
| for (base::FilePath name = consent_files.Next(); !name.empty(); |
| name = consent_files.Next()) { |
| SafeFD::SafeFDResult file_err = |
| root_err.first.OpenExistingFile(name, O_RDONLY | O_CLOEXEC); |
| if (SafeFD::IsError(file_err.second)) { |
| LOG(ERROR) << "Failed to open file: " << name.value() << ": " |
| << static_cast<int>(file_err.second); |
| continue; |
| } |
| auto read_result = file_err.first.ReadContents(); |
| if (SafeFD::IsError(read_result.second)) { |
| LOG(ERROR) << "Failed to read file: " << name.value() << ": " |
| << static_cast<int>(read_result.second); |
| continue; |
| } |
| checked_any = true; |
| std::string consent(read_result.first.begin(), read_result.first.end()); |
| if (consent != "1") { |
| return false; |
| } |
| } |
| |
| if (checked_any) { |
| // If we got here and didn't bail, all active users consented. |
| return true; |
| } |
| return std::nullopt; |
| } |
| |
| bool MetricsLibrary::AreMetricsEnabled() { |
| time_t this_check_time = time(nullptr); |
| if (this_check_time != cached_enabled_time_) { |
| cached_enabled_time_ = this_check_time; |
| |
| std::optional<bool> user_consent = ArePerUserMetricsEnabled(); |
| if (user_consent.has_value() && !user_consent.value()) { |
| // If the user consented, also make sure device owner opted in. |
| // (Theoretically, if device policy is off, the user shouldn't be *able* |
| // to opt in based on the current-as-of-2022-03 design, but add this as |
| // a secondary layer of defense.) |
| // If the user opted out, we opt out. |
| cached_enabled_ = false; |
| return false; |
| } |
| |
| if (!policy_provider_.get()) |
| policy_provider_.reset(new policy::PolicyProvider()); |
| policy_provider_->Reload(); |
| |
| const policy::DevicePolicy* device_policy = nullptr; |
| if (policy_provider_->device_policy_is_loaded()) |
| device_policy = &policy_provider_->GetDevicePolicy(); |
| |
| // If policy couldn't be loaded or the metrics policy is not set, default to |
| // enabled for enterprise-enrolled devices, cf. https://crbug/456186, or |
| // respect the consent file if it is present for migration purposes. In all |
| // other cases, default to disabled. |
| // TODO(pastarmovj) |
| std::string id_unused; |
| bool metrics_enabled = false; |
| bool metrics_policy = false; |
| if (device_policy && device_policy->GetMetricsEnabled(&metrics_policy)) { |
| metrics_enabled = metrics_policy; |
| VLOG(2) << "AreMetricsEnabled: " << metrics_enabled << " (device policy)"; |
| } else if (device_policy && device_policy->IsEnterpriseManaged()) { |
| metrics_enabled = true; |
| VLOG(2) << "AreMetricsEnabled: 1 (enterprise managed)"; |
| } else { |
| metrics_enabled = ConsentId(&id_unused); |
| VLOG(2) << "AreMetricsEnabled: " << metrics_enabled |
| << "(consent ID file)"; |
| } |
| cached_enabled_ = (metrics_enabled && !IsGuestMode()); |
| } |
| return cached_enabled_; |
| } |
